# Break-Glass: Catalog Cache Invalidation

Scope: the Pinrow product catalog at Veldstone Retail. If stale prices persist after a purge and the Hollowmere invalidation queue is wedged, use break-glass to flush the edge tier directly. Contractors: get verbal sign-off from the catalog lead first. Steps: open the Hollowmere admin shell, select emergency-flush, confirm the tenant, and run it once — repeated flushes thrash the origin. Access is logged and expires after 20 minutes. Unseal the admin shell with the passphrase below.

recovery phrase for kahop-tajog: istix-casvan

### Escalation — Sweepster Orphan Cleanup

If Sweepster flags more than 500 orphaned volumes in one pass, don't panic — it's usually a stale tag filter, not an actual leak. Pause the sweep with `sweepster halt`, snapshot the candidate list, and ping the infra channel. If the list includes anything tagged `release-locked`, that's a hard stop: nothing gets deleted until the Calderon Cloud platform leads sign off. For sign-off requests or anything you can't untangle within an hour, email the sweeper owners.

alerts address for kafog-haweg: wendor.ulaael@zemvarworks.internal

## Changelog — Font vendoring defaults changed

As of this release, the Bracken UI build no longer fetches third-party fonts at build time. All typefaces used by the Lanternwell suite are now vendored into the repo under a dedicated assets directory, and the fetch step is skipped by default. If you're onboarding, nothing to install — the fonts travel with the checkout. The build flags controlling this behavior are listed below.

settings of hadup-yafog:
LAMAEL_PIN=3761
LAMAEL_TENANT=istmir
LAMAEL_METRICS_HOST=metrics.lamael.plorvasys.test
LAMAEL_SEAL=seal_8ea68500
LAMAEL_STANDBY_TEAM=fraok

Leadership Review Briefing — Heads of Department, Quillmark Logistics

Heads up before the review: one client, Bastervale Retail Group, now accounts for 43% of our revenue — up from 28% two years ago. Great account, but if they renegotiate or walk, we have a real problem. Renata's team has mapped out three diversification moves: pushing harder into the Ostley corridor, reviving the cold-chain pilot, and a partnership play we'll discuss live. Nothing alarming yet, but we need to act this year. Context on the longer-term plan follows below.

board note of fafog-yahap: Project Rusdor slips by a full year because of the audit delay.